Unlocking Reishi's Power for Endurance Training

Reishi fungus has been revered in Traditional Chinese Medicine for centuries as a potent adaptogen. Growing scientific research is now uncovering the remarkable benefits of reishi for endurance athletes. This unique fungus can boost your athletic performance by augmenting energy levels, minimizing inflammation, and promoting faster recovery.

One of the key ways reishi supports endurance training is by stabilizing stress hormones. When you push your body to its limits during intense workouts, your cortisol levels spike. High cortisol can result fatigue, muscle breakdown, and a diminished immune system. Reishi helps dampen these negative effects by regulating your body's stress response.

Additionally, reishi is packed with antioxidants that combat free radicals created during exercise. These harmful molecules can impair cells and tissues, leading read more to inflammation and muscle soreness. By removing these free radicals, reishi helps shield your body from oxidative stress, allowing you to train harder.

  • Reishi can also improve sleep quality, which is essential for recovery and muscle repair.
  • Adding reishi into your pre-workout routine can deliver a natural energy boost without the jitters or crash associated with caffeine.
  • By optimizing your immune system, reishi helps you avoid illness and avoid missing valuable training time.
